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

關於license #859

Closed
3 tasks done
codergr opened this issue Dec 11, 2024 · 3 comments
Closed
3 tasks done

關於license #859

codergr opened this issue Dec 11, 2024 · 3 comments
Labels

Comments

@codergr
Copy link

codergr commented Dec 11, 2024

Issue Checklist

Other Information

您好,請問如果

  1. 我更改_config.yml中的某些選項,如:menu新增隱私權政策的頁面的選項,我也需要公開我的_config.yml嗎? (依據NexT的license與GNU Affero General Public License version 3,如果我的理解沒有錯誤的話?)
  2. 如果我將頁腳的copyright格式由© 2024 <fa fa-heart> <author>改成2024 © <author>,需要公開修改過後的控制footer的檔案嗎?
  3. 如果以上兩點的答案是肯定的,我需要附上GNU Affero General Public License version 3或說明是依據此條款進行修改與授權嗎?

謝謝。

Copy link

welcome bot commented Dec 11, 2024

Thanks for opening this issue, maintainers will get back to you as soon as possible!

@stevenjoezhang
Copy link
Member

您好,

  1. Hexo允许通过名为_config.next.yml的配置覆盖默认配置,而无需修改主题的源代码,因此可以不受到AGPL协议约束
  2. 如果是直接修改了footer.njk,那么根据AGPL协议,需要公開修改過後的控制footer的檔案;不过,Hexo实际上也有插件允许在不直接修改主题的情况下任意覆盖主题源码,可以参考 https://github.com/jiangtj/hexo-extend-theme
  3. 如果是的话,需要附上AGPL协议;也可以使用其他方式在不修改主题源码的情况下进行自定义

有其他问题欢迎继续回复。

@codergr
Copy link
Author

codergr commented Dec 17, 2024

好的!非常感謝您的協助!

@codergr codergr closed this as completed Dec 17,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

2 participants